
German-style goulash is a rich and flavorful dish, typical of German cuisine. The beef is slowly cooked with onions, butter, and spices, creating a creamy and tasty sauce. It is often served with boiled potatoes or dumplings. Try this recipe and travel while enjoying an authentic German dish!

Partially freeze the piece of meat so it is easier to cut, then slice it into 1 cm thick pieces
Cut each slice into strips and then cut these into cubes
Melt the butter in a casserole dish and sauté the finely chopped onions over moderate heat for 3-4 minutes, stirring constantly with a wooden spoon
Sprinkle the soffritto with a teaspoon of paprika and lower the heat to minimum to allow the spicy powder to be absorbed by the seasoning and the onions
Be careful not to let it burn
Add the tomato paste, stirring carefully to blend it well, then pour in the vinegar
Salt the meat cubes and put them in the casserole dish, then season everything with garlic, cumin, and marjoram
Pour enough water over the preparation to cover it lightly and cook over moderate heat with the container covered for 20 minutes
After the indicated time, add the peeled and diced potatoes
Pour in more water so as to cover the ingredients and place the stew in the preheated oven (150 degrees) uncovered for about two hours
